Shadowrocket default.conf详解:配置文件解读与使用技巧

1. 简介

Shadowrocket是一款iOS设备上常用的代理工具,而default.conf则是其配置文件,通过对该文件的修改可以实现更加个性化的代理设置。

2. default.conf文件结构

default.conf文件采用了简洁明了的YAML格式,主要包括以下几个部分:

  • proxy:代理设置
  • rules:规则设置
  • script:脚本设置
  • adblock:广告屏蔽设置

3. 常见配置项

3.1 代理设置

  • type:代理类型,常见值包括HTTP、SOCKS5、Shadowsocks等
  • server:代理服务器地址
  • port:代理服务器端口
  • cipher:加密算法(仅适用于Shadowsocks)

3.2 规则设置

  • type:规则类型,如DOMAIN-SUFFIX、DOMAIN-KEYWORD等
  • value:规则匹配值
  • policy:匹配策略,通常为PROXY或DIRECT

3.3 脚本设置

  • type:脚本类型,如url-test、select等
  • url:脚本地址(仅适用于url-test)
  • interval:检测间隔时间(仅适用于url-test)

3.4 广告屏蔽设置

  • enabled:是否启用广告屏蔽
  • url:广告屏蔽规则列表地址

4. 使用技巧

  • 修改代理服务器地址和端口以连接不同的代理
  • 添加自定义规则以实现更精细化的流量控制
  • 使用脚本功能实现定时检测和切换代理
  • 启用广告屏蔽功能,提升浏览体验

常见问题

Q: 如何编辑default.conf文件?

A: 用户可以通过文本编辑器如Notepad++或编辑器应用如iFile进行编辑。

Q: default.conf文件的保存路径是什么?

A: 在iOS设备上,default.conf文件通常保存在Shadowrocket应用的沙盒目录下。

Q: 如何备份和恢复default.conf文件?

A: 用户可以通过iTunes或iCloud进行备份,恢复时将备份文件放置到Shadowrocket应用的沙盒目录即可。

Q: 如何查看default.conf文件是否生效?

A: 用户可以在Shadowrocket应用中的日志界面查看代理和规则是否按照配置文件中的设置进行生效。

正文完